HER Number:MDV8230
Name:Hut circle 275m south-west of Meacombe

Summary

On the flat ridge top within an area of bracken lies the remains of a probable Bronze Age hut circle. It is now visible as a sub-circular depression 7.5 metres in diameter and 0.3 metres deep with an almost complete perimeter kerb of stones averaging 1.1 metres long, 0.3 metres wide and protruding 0.2 metres above the ground.

Robinson, R., 1982, List of Field Monument Warden Visits 1982 (Un-published). SDV342809.

(Visited 17/3/1982) Hut circle or kerb circle lying on crest of spur of hill. A semi-circle remains: a kerb of 7 close-set stones, with a gap on the e side. When complete, diameter would have been c.8.3m. Centre slightly hollow, level turf. This is very similar to the description of sam 724, which fmw's of late have been unable to find. It is probable that it has been mislocated on the scheduling document, and that this and sx78nw/9 are the same site.

Ordnance Survey Archaeology Division, 1982, SX78NW42 (Ordnance Survey Archaeology Division Card). SDV305898.

(16/03/1982) SX 72628652. On the flat ridge top at approximately 252m. O.D. within an area of bracken lies the remains of a probable hut cirle. It is now visible as a sub-circular depression 7.5m. in diameter and 0.3m. deep with an almost complete perimeter kerb of stones averaging 1.1m. long, 0.3m. wide and protruding 0.2m. above the ground. (See Ground Photograph). For a probable BA enclosure and field system nearby see SX 78 NW 10.

Turner, J. R., 1990, Ring Cairns, Stone Circles and Related Monuments on Dartmoor, 42 71 fig 16, D1 (Article in Serial). SDV229817.

A small orthostatic circle, diameter 8.9m. The close spaced stones project only a few cms above ground around part of the circumference of a semi-circular depression. Measures 14m from the centre, opposite the gap in the ring, there is a large boulder, possibly an outlier.
